Output 4488d13268f6b1eb363a94d4be508f4d92a1887904bfb56ebd64e812530c6880:3

value
103818546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1e95195fedd6032bca5200df6627a3a8746d6f OP_EQUAL
address
3HZg8prgtUsnVzUpyyRypRw65ztkSKbU3n
transaction
4488d13268f6b1eb363a94d4be508f4d92a1887904bfb56ebd64e812530c6880
spent
true